首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Android精进之路-01】定计划,重行动来学Android

Android精进之路第一篇,确定安卓学习计划。 干货满满,建议收藏,需要用到时常看看。小伙伴们如有问题及需要,欢迎踊跃留言哦~ ~ ~。...答:这里我学习Android最直接的原因就是领导要求学习的,并且项目组急需一个会Android开发的后端开发。有现成的项目给我参考。这里学习该技术的时机已经成熟。并不会说,学习了技术没地方用。...答:这里我计划花费1个多月的时间进行Android技术的学习,主要是入门基础知识的学习。 学习路线图 这里我选择了C语言中文网的Android教程。原因主要是因为C语言中文网上的教程通俗易懂。...不掌握Java基础是无法学习Android的。闲话少叙:让我们直接来看学习路线图。 这里最重要的几个基础 Android的程序结构,GUI开发以及网络编程。所以,这几块我将重点花时间进行学习。...2.找项目练手 可以在Github或者在Gitee上搜索 Android 练手项目就可以找好多好多项目。大家可以自行取用。 总结 本文介绍了本人学习Android的计划安排。

41520
您找到你想要的搜索结果了吗?
是的
没有找到

ListView 原理的介绍 qt也可以想通的Android

转载请注明出处:http://blog.csdn.net/guolin_blog/article/details/44996879 在Android所有常用的原生控件当中,用法最复杂的应该就是ListView...于是现在我又重新定下心来再次把ListView的源码重读了一遍,那么这次我一定要把它写成一篇博客,分享给大家的同时也当成我自己的笔记。...那么显然Android开发团队是不会允许这种事情发生的,于是就有了Adapter这样一个机制的出现。... *   * @see android.widget.AbsListView#setRecyclerListener(android.widget.AbsListView.RecyclerListener...第一次Layout 不管怎么说,ListView即使再特殊最终还是继承自View的,因此它的执行流程还将会按照View的规则来执行,对于这方面不太熟悉的朋友可以参考我之前写的 Android视图绘制流程完全解析

48710

救救孩子,快看个面试题

简述Android虚拟机和JAVA虚拟机的区别 Android虚拟机:即DVM(Dalvik Virtual Machine),为啥不叫AVM?...Dalvik 是 Google 公司自己设计用于 Android 平台的 Java虚拟机,每一个Android 应用程序都拥有一个独立的Dalvik 虚拟机实例,应用程序都在它自己的进程中运行。...Android 工程编译后的所有.class字节码会被dex工具抽取到一个.dex文件中。...Dalvik负责进程隔离和线程管理,每一个Android应用在底层都会对应一个独立的Dalvik虚拟机实例,其代码在虚拟机的解释下得以执行。...Android有一个特殊的虚拟机进程Zygote,他是虚拟机实例的孵化器。它在系统启动的时候就会产生,它会完成虚拟机的初始化,库的加载,预制类库和初始化的操作。

88710

Android数据库高手秘籍(九),赶快使用LitePal 2.0版本

以后不管你是用Java还是Kotlin开发Android程序,都可以100%兼容地使用LitePal,是不是有点小激动呢?那么下面我们就来具体学习一下如何使用新版本的LitePal。...未来使用Kotlin编写Android程序的人会越来越多,因此LitePal也及时跟进,全面支持了Kotlin语言。 下面我来给大家简单演示下如何在Kotlin代码中使用LitePal。...首先要定义一个实体类,这里我们就以Book类为例。...当然,除了这些新功能之外,我还修复了一些已知的bug,提升了整体框架的稳定性,如果这些正是你所需要的话,那就赶快升级。 我没学过LitePal怎么办?...另外也可以阅读我写的专栏《Android数据库高手秘籍》,同样对LitePal的各种使用方法进行了详细地剖析。

76460
领券